Surrey First-Class Matches in 1967

See Also List A Matches and Second XI Matches and Other Matches

Captain: MJ Stewart

Home Grounds used:
Kennington Oval, Kennington; Woodbridge Road, Guildford

Away Grounds visited:
The University Parks, Oxford; Lord's Cricket Ground, St John's Wood; County Ground, Northampton; Queen's Park, Chesterfield; Griff and Coton Ground, Nuneaton; May's Bounty, Basingstoke; Ashley Down Ground, Bristol; Headingley, Leeds; Old Trafford, Manchester; Grace Road, Leicester; Mote Park, Maidstone; Trent Bridge, Nottingham; County Ground, Hove; Clarence Park, Weston-super-Mare; County Ground, Chelmsford

Championship playing record:
P 28     W 8     D 16     L 4

First-Class playing record:
P 32     W 9     D 19     L 4

21 players appeared in First-Class matches for Surrey in 1967:
GG Arnold; KF Barrington; JH Edrich; MJ Edwards; IW Finlay; D Gibson; R Harman; JMM Hooper; RD Jackman; A Long; DA Marriott; PI Pocock; GRJ Roope; SG Russell; WA Smith; MJ Stewart; SJ Storey; DJS Taylor; CE Waller; MD Willett; Younis Ahmed.

3 players made their debut for Surrey in these matches in 1967:
JMM Hooper; SG Russell; CE Waller.
